What is a Problem-Solving Flowchart? (And Why You Need One)

A problem-solving flowchart is a visual tool that shows each step, decision, and possible outcome in order. Think of it as your personal decision-making GPS. It helps you see where you are, what choices you have, and where each option could lead.

Unlike traditional list-making or mental brainstorming, a flowchart maps the entire landscape of your problem in a single view, showing not just what needs to happen, but also the critical decision points that determine your path forward.

Circumventing Cognitive Biases

One of the most powerful (yet overlooked) benefits of flowchart thinking is how it helps you overcome cognitive biases that sabotage problem-solving:

· Confirmation Bias: When you map out all possible paths (not just the ones you prefer), you're forced to objectively evaluate options you might otherwise dismiss.

· Anchoring Bias: By visualizing the entire process, you prevent yourself from fixating on the first solution that comes to mind.

· Sunk Cost Fallacy: A flowchart helps you evaluate decisions based on future outcomes, not past investments.

The structure of flowcharts encourages you to look at things objectively. Every path leads somewhere, and every decision has clear rules. This approach helps you avoid emotional or rushed choices.

Essential Flowchart Symbols for Problem-Solving

Standardized symbols are the universal language of flowcharts. Like road signs that everyone can understand, these flowchart symbols make your diagrams easy to read, whether you review them months later or share them with your team. Understanding these core symbols is crucial for DIY success. Here are the essential building blocks:

⬭ (Oval)TerminatorMarks the start or end of your problem-solving process. Every flowchart needs clear entry and exit points.
▭ (Rectangle)ProcessRepresents a specific action, task, or step you must complete. This is where work happens.
◇ (Diamond)DecisionShows a critical point where a choice must be made, with multiple paths based on the answer.
→ (Arrow)ConnectorIndicates the direction of flow and the sequence of steps. Arrows guide the reader through your logic.
▱ (Parallelogram)Input/OutputRepresents data or information entering the process (input) or being produced (output).
● (Circle)On-Page ConnectorConnects different parts of a flowchart on the same page when lines would become cluttered.
⌂ (Home Plate)Off-Page ConnectorLinks to another part of the flowchart on a different page for complex, multi-page processes.
Pro Tip: You don't need to memorize every specialized symbol. For most DIY problem-solving, you'll primarily use four key tools: 'The Starter Oval' (Terminator), 'The Action Rectangle' (Process), 'The Gatekeeper Diamond' (Decision), and 'The Navigator Arrow' (Connector). Master these four, and you can tackle 90% of problems effectively.

Consistency is important. After you pick your symbols, use them the same way in your whole flowchart. This creates a visual language that feels natural as you solve the problem.

Step 1: Define the Problem Clearly

This is the most important step. Rushing past problem definition is the #1 reason flowcharts fail to deliver results. You can't solve what you don't understand.

Articulating the Problem Statement: Use the classic journalism questions to crystallize your thinking:

· What is the problem? (Be specific, not vague)

· Where does it occur? (Context matters)

· When does it happen? (Always? Sometimes? Under what conditions?)

· Who is affected? (Understanding stakeholders shapes solutions)

· Why is this a problem? (What's the actual impact?)

· How severe is it? (Priority level)

Setting the Scope: Draw clear boundaries around what you're addressing. What's included in your flowchart? What's explicitly out of scope? This prevents scope creep and keeps your diagram focused.

Self-Reflection Questions:

· "Am I solving the symptom or the underlying cause?"

· "What would success look like?"

· "What assumptions am I making?"

Expert Reminder: "Define the Problem Clearly: Before drawing, spend time articulating the problem statement precisely. A well-defined problem is half-solved."

Step 2: Identify Your Start and End Points

Every journey needs a beginning and a destination.

Where does the problem begin? Identify the initial trigger or symptom that signals the problem exists. This becomes your "Start" terminator. It might be an error message, a customer complaint, a missed deadline, or a personal frustration.

What does a successful resolution look like? Describe the "end state"—the specific outcome that signals the problem is solved. This becomes your "End" terminator. Be concrete: "Internet working properly" is better than "Problem fixed."

Step 5: Add Decision Points and Outcomes

This is where flowcharts truly shine. Look at your sequence and identify every point where a question must be answered or a choice must be made. These become diamond-shaped decision symbols.

Using Decision Diamonds Effectively:

Every decision should have at least two clear paths, such as "Yes/No," "True/False," or specific options like "Option A/B/C." Try to avoid choices that are vague or unclear.

Mapping Consequences: Each path from a decision diamond leads somewhere:

· Another process step

· Another decision point

· An endpoint (problem solved or different outcome)

· Sometimes, back to an earlier step (creating a loop for retries)

Expert Reminder: "Identify All Decision Points: Every diamond (decision symbol) should have at least two clear paths (e.g., Yes/No, True/False) to guide the user."

Step 6: Review, Test, and Refine

Your first draft is done! Now it's time to make it even better:

Review for Clarity: Can someone else follow your flowchart without explanation? Is the language clear and unambiguous?

Test Completeness: Walk through your flowchart with different scenarios:

· The happy path (everything works perfectly)

· Common errors or obstacles

· Edge cases or unusual situations

Check Logical Consistency: Do all paths lead somewhere? Are there any dead ends? Does every decision account for all possible answers?

Expert Reminder: "Test Your Flowchart: Mentally walk through your flowchart with a hypothetical scenario or an actual problem to identify logical gaps or redundancies."

Look for Redundancies: Are you repeating steps unnecessarily? Can any processes be consolidated?

Get Feedback: If the problem affects others, share your flowchart and ask for their perspective. Fresh eyes catch what you miss.

Example 1: Troubleshooting Home Wi-Fi Issues

Wi-Fi troubleshooting flowchart

Scenario: Your internet isn't working, and you need to get back online quickly.

Flowchart Breakdown:

flowchart TD
    A[⬭ START: Internet not working] --> B{◇ Are other devices affected?}
    B -->|No| C[Check device settings]
    C --> D[Restart device]
    D --> END1[⬭ END: Problem resolved]
    B -->|Yes| E{◇ Are router lights normal?}
    E -->|No| F[Check power connection]
    F --> G[Restart router]
    G --> H[Wait 2-3 minutes for connection]
    E -->|Yes| H
    H --> I{◇ Is the internet working now?}
    I -->|Yes| END1
    I -->|No| J[Contact ISP for service issue]
    J --> END2[⬭ END: Problem unresolved - ISP help needed]

Why This Works: Rather than guessing at solutions, the flowchart leads you through logical steps. You rule out each possibility one by one until you either solve the problem or know it's time to call for help.

Best Practices for Effective Problem-Solving Flowcharting

Now that you understand the basics, let's elevate your flowcharting skills with these proven best practices.

1. Keep Language Simple and Direct

Expert Reminder: "Keep It Concise: Use clear, unambiguous language within each symbol. Avoid lengthy descriptions that can clutter the diagram."

Use short, action-oriented phrases:

· ✅ Good: "Restart computer"

· ❌ Poor: "Please proceed to restart your computer system by shutting down all applications first."

Avoid jargon unless your audience is guaranteed to understand it. Remember: clarity beats cleverness every time.

2. Maintain Consistency Throughout

Expert Reminder: "Use Consistent Symbols: Adhere to standard flowchart symbols (e.g., rectangles for processes, diamonds for decisions) for clarity and universal understanding."

· Use the same symbol for the same type of element every time.

· Keep formatting consistent (same colors, fonts, sizing)

· Maintain consistent spacing between elements.

· Use the same language style throughout (all imperative voice: "Check settings," not mixing with "Settings are checked")

Being consistent makes your flowchart look professional and makes it easier for others to understand.

3. Balance Detail Appropriately

Know when to drill down and when to generalize. Too much detail creates overwhelming clutter; too little leaves critical gaps.

Rule of thumb: If a process box contains more than 7-10 words, consider breaking it into multiple steps, or consider whether you're overexplaining.

For complex sub-processes, use an off-page connector to link to a detailed sub-flowchart rather than cramming everything onto one diagram.

Common Mistakes to Avoid When Building Your Flowchart

Learn from others' errors. Avoid these six pitfalls that trip up even experienced flowchart creators.

Mistake #1: Overcomplicating the Initial Draft

The Problem: Trying to capture every nuance and detail in your first attempt leads to analysis paralysis and abandoned flowcharts.

The Solution: Begin with a broad and simple outline. Write down the main steps and decisions first. You can add more details later. A finished simple flowchart is better than a perfect one that never gets done.

Mistake #2: Creating Ambiguous Decision Points

The Problem: Decision diamonds with unclear paths, such as "Maybe," "Depends," or "Sometimes," don't actually guide decision-making.

The Solution: Every decision must have clear, mutually exclusive, and collectively exhaustive options. If you can't clearly answer the question with the available paths, reformulate the decision.

· ❌ Poor: ◇ "Should I proceed?" → Maybe

· ✅ Good: ◇ "Do all prerequisites meet minimum requirements?" → Yes / No

Mistake #3: Misusing Symbols

The Problem: Using process rectangles for decisions, or decision diamonds for actions, creates confusion and misinterpretation.

The Solution: Stick strictly to standard symbol meanings:

· Rectangles = Actions/processes

· Diamonds = Questions/decisions requiring a choice

· Ovals = Start/end points only

If you're unsure, check the symbol guide again. Staying consistent is important.

Mistake #4: Ignoring Edge Cases and Exceptions

The Problem: If you only design your flowchart for the ideal situation, you won't be ready when things go wrong—and they often do.

The Solution: Actively brainstorm what could go wrong, what unusual circumstances might occur, and how rare situations should be handled. Add decision points and alternative paths for these scenarios.

Ask: "What if this step fails?" "What if the data is missing?" "What if the user chooses an unexpected option?"

Mistake #5: Skipping the Testing Phase

The Problem: Assuming your first draft is correct without validation leads to discovering flaws only when applying the flowchart to real situations.

The Solution: Always test with multiple scenarios before considering your flowchart complete. Walk through it step by step, playing out different "what if" situations. Even better, have someone unfamiliar with the problem try to follow your flowchart without your guidance.

Mistake #6: Missing Clear Start and End Points

The Problem: Flowcharts that begin or end ambiguously leave users confused about when to use them and when they're done.

The Solution: Always use terminator symbols (ovals) to explicitly mark:

· START: The specific trigger or condition that initiates the process

· END: The specific outcome or resolution that completes the process

Multiple endpoints are acceptable (representing different outcomes), but each must be clearly labeled.

When to Reach for a Problem-Solving Flowchart

Flowcharts aren't necessary for every problem—sometimes a simple list or quick decision suffices. Here's when flowcharts deliver the most value.

Complex, Multi-Step Problems

When your problem involves numerous sequential actions, dependencies between steps, or requires coordination across multiple phases, flowcharts provide clarity that lists cannot match.

Examples:

· Project planning with multiple stakeholders

· IT troubleshooting with many variables.

· Hiring processes with screening stages

· Complex customer service protocols

Why Flowcharts Help: They show you which steps depend on others, where things might get stuck, and the most important path to follow. You can see not just what needs to happen, but also the right order and conditions for each step.

Repetitive Issues Requiring Consistent Approaches

When the same problem occurs regularly and needs a standardized response, flowcharts create repeatable processes that ensure consistency and quality.

Examples:

· Customer onboarding procedures

· Quality control inspections

· Routine maintenance protocols

· Recurring monthly closing processes

Why Flowcharts Help: They save you from having to figure things out from scratch every time, help prevent mistakes by using the same process, and make it much easier to train new people.

Situations Requiring Team Alignment

When multiple people need to understand and execute the same process, flowcharts provide shared understanding that transcends verbal explanations.

Examples:

· Cross-functional project workflows

· Collaborative problem-solving sessions

· Documenting team procedures

· Explaining complex processes to stakeholders

Why Flowcharts Help: Pictures are quicker and clearer than long explanations. When everyone can see the same diagram, it's easier to avoid misunderstandings.
